About Over Wallop Recreation Ground
It's a nature reserve in the truest sense: managed for wildlife first, visitors second. You get chalk-loving plants, breeding grounds for ground-nesting birds in spring, and enough space to walk for a solid hour without seeing another soul. The recreation ground element means there are paths, though nothing fancy - this isn't about interpretive boards and visitor centres.
Walkers will get the most from it. Birdwatchers absolutely should come during breeding season (April to June). Families with young kids might find an hour here enough before restlessness sets in, unless your lot are genuinely into spotting things through binoculars. History buffs will appreciate the landscape's ancient grazing heritage, though there's nothing dramatic to look at.
Admission is free, naturally. Allow two to three hours if you're doing a proper ramble, forty minutes if you're just stretching legs. Early morning or dusk offers the best wildlife watching.
